Greenlane Renewables: core business model

Greenlane Renewables designs, engineers, and supplies biogas upgrading systems that purify raw biogas into renewable natural gas (RNG), suitable for injection into natural gas grids or use as vehicle fuel. Operating primarily in Canada and the US, the company targets landfills, wastewater facilities, and farms producing biogas from organic waste. Its technology portfolio includes membrane separation and water wash systems, with over 100 units installed globally as of the 2025 annual report published March 28, 2026, per company IR as of 03/28/2026.

The business model relies on turnkey project sales, long-term service agreements, and operations & maintenance (O&M) contracts, providing recurring revenue. In Q1 2026, service revenues grew 15% year-over-year to CAD 2.1 million for the period ended March 31, 2026, according to the earnings release dated May 8, 2026.

Main revenue and product drivers for Greenlane Renewables

Revenue is driven by sales of proprietary biogas upgrading plants, with key products like the FLEX and Fortis systems catering to different scales of operations. A major driver is the North American RNG market expansion, fueled by low-carbon fuel standards in California and federal incentives under the US Inflation Reduction Act. The company secured a CAD 12 million order for a landfill project in the US Midwest in late 2025, contributing to backlog visibility into 2027, as noted in the Q4 2025 results published March 28, 2026.

Service and O&M contracts represent about 30% of revenues, offering stable cash flows. For Q1 2026, total revenues reached CAD 5.8 million, up 8% from Q1 2025, primarily from services and parts, per the May 8, 2026 filing.

Industry trends and competitive position

The RNG sector is projected to grow at 20% CAGR through 2030, driven by decarbonization mandates and RNG qualifying for renewable fuel credits worth up to USD 3 per gasoline gallon equivalent. Greenlane holds a strong position with its CNG and LNG fueling station integration capabilities, competing with firms like Brightmark and Vanguard Renewables. Its Canadian base provides access to similar incentives, enhancing US market exposure.
